We are very excited to announce an event that should become a major new addition to your beer-drinking calendar: Taste of the Brewvitational. It will be held May 11 at Reading Terminal Market.

With the Inquirer's Brewvitational competition for local beers now in its eighth year, we decided it was time to create an opportunity for the public to get involved. We will host a public tasting event, inviting beer lovers to gather with an estimated 30 local brewers to sip and vote for their favorite local craft beers.

The Brewvitational, with its private panel of expert judges, will take place earlier that day, in the same way it always has. Those judges will taste two other categories: best "new" beer, and this year's featured style, lagers.

The winners of all three categories will be announced that night at the Market. Molly Malloy's and All About Events catering will partner with us to help it all run smoothly.
